Bopara out, Wright in at Old Trafford

18:45, Sep 10 2012

 

England dropped Ravi Bopara for the second match of their NatWest International Twenty20 series at Old Trafford as captain Stuart Broad won the toss and elected to bowl.

The Essex batsman's position had been the subject of scrutiny after a series of low scores since his season was interrupted by unspecified personal problems in July. Bopara's place went to Sussex all-rounder Luke Wright while South Africa, who won the opener at the Emirates Durham ICG on Saturday, made two changes.

Hashim Amla took the place of Faf du Plessis at number three while paceman Morne Morkel replaced Lonwabo Tsotsobe.

The match was delayed by light rain just as the players were preparing for the first ball.
